St Leonard’s big win

St Leonard’s Boys School has won in most categories of the Barbados Community College Language Centre’s French and Spanish language Encuentro/Rencontres competitions.
The school gained 106 points to win the challenge trophy, beating the nearest rival, Springer Memorial School, by a whopping 86 points.
The competition had an oral element, as well as a poster competition and dramatization.  Here, the students and Spanish teachers Mr Burke (left) and Mr Lewis (right) pose with some of the many trophies they collected on Friday. (LK)
